AN AMENDMENT TO CHAPTER 54 OF THE RAMSEY CITY CODE, WHICH <br />CHAPTER IS KNOWN AS THE TRAFFIC AND VEHICLE CHAPTER OF THE <br />RAMSEY, MINNESOTA, CITY CODE. <br />AN ORDINANCE AMENDING ARTICLE IV, SECTIONS 96 -105 RECREATIONAL <br />VEHICLES. <br />The City of Ramsey ordains: <br />SECTION 1. AUTHORITY <br />This ordinance is adopted pursuant to and under the authority of the City Charter of the City of <br />Ramsey. <br />SECTION 2. REPEAL <br />Article IV Recreational Vehicles of the City Code is hereby repealed and replaced with the <br />following new Article IV Recreational Vehicles. <br />SECTION 3. AMENDMENTS <br />Sec. 54 -96. - Purpose. <br />The purpose of this article is to provide reasonable regulations for the use of recreational <br />vehicles on public and private property in the city. This article in not intended to allow what the <br />Minnesota state statutes expressly prohibit nor to prohibit what the state statutes allow.
